CHE officials believe one barrier is the overwhelming number of degree choices. Since the early 2000s, Indiana’s public institutions have added more than 1,000 bachelor’s degree programs—a 40% increase, even as enrollment has declined.
Though the 60-year-old bridge welcomes traffic again, it won't stay around forever. Over a decade in the making, the county has a replacement bridge planned upstream of the Blackiston Mill Bridge. Construction is expected to start at the beginning of next year, according to Floyd County Commissioner Al Knable.
